Police Scotland: Books 4-6
(2025)(A book in the Police Scotland Edinburgh Crime Thrillers series)
An omnibus of novels by Ed James
The second collection of Police Scotland books.
Twenty years in the cask. Now the past won’t stay buried.
At a distillery deep in Midlothian countryside near Dalkeith, a master blender cracks open a cask laid down twenty years ago.
Inside is more than whisky.
The mangled corpse has no ID. No easy answers. And nobody else in CID wants the case.
DC Scott Cullen is used to being sidelined by his arrogant boss, DI Bain but now he’s lead on a murder buried decades deep. Two distillery workers vanished within weeks of each other, just as the barrel was sealed. As Cullen digs into a past soaked in rivalry and rumour, he’s forced to untangle decades of silence from a family that’s not telling everything.
Now it’s Cullen’s job to find out who the body belongs to and whether the killer is still around to strike again.
When a car is found at the base of Winchburgh bing outside Linlithgow, DC Scott Cullen is one of the first on the scene. The body inside is young, male and apparently killed on impact.
As Cullen follows the trail into the violent world of football hooliganism, he finds himself tangled in a case that’s dangerously close to home and dangerously out of control.
With a looming restructure and his personal life in freefall, even his job’s on the line. They say Cullen’s a liability this case might prove them right.
Things are finally going well for Acting Detective Sergeant Scott Cullen Scott Cullen. He’s just moved in with his girlfriend and, thanks to the recent police force merger, the promotion he craves is almost in reach. Just so long as he can keep out of trouble
Then a severely decomposed body of a man is found in the labyrinthine alleyways of Edinburgh’s Old Town with a screwdriver through his heart. A message daubed on the wall:
I will kill again.
As Cullen races against time to save lives, the investigation leads him to unsettled scores in the music industry, where bands and their bitter rivalries might just have turned murderous.
Then Cullen’s relationship takes an alarming turn, just as the unsolved case begins to weigh heavily on him.
His maverick tactics have helped him in the past, but will they come back to haunt him and put others in danger?
